A client onboarding associate is responsible for facilitating the smooth transition of new clients into a company's products or services. They play a crucial role in building strong relationships with clients by ensuring their needs are met and expectations are exceeded. The associate works closely with various internal departments, such as sales, marketing, and customer support, to gather necessary information and documentation from clients. They assist in the completion of required paperwork, contracts, and agreements, while also providing guidance and support throughout the onboarding process. Additionally, they may conduct training sessions to familiarize clients with the company's offerings and help them maximize their benefits. A client onboarding associate must possess excellent communication and interpersonal skills, attention to detail, and the ability to multitask effectively.

Client Onboarding Associate salary in Greece
Average Yearly Salary of Client Onboarding Associate in Greece is approximately 19,094 EUR (19,121 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
